Back to Alexis—born in Nottingham, UK, he was the geeky kid with a passion for business. After studying management science at Loughborough University, he found his true calling in management consultancy. His ability to break down processes and create systems led him to co-found AirManual and SpiderGap, software services that support business growth and efficiency.

Can you ask for help? Have you ever noticed how there are two types of people in this world? Those who can easily ask for help, and those fiercely independent souls like myself. My dad was the same way, always wanting to do things independently, even when he was struggling. It’s something I inherited, but boy, does it make life harder sometimes!( It's funny, having processed this show for you, I realised I did not ask for your help. See the note at the end. )
We humans are meant to collaborate and share tasks—that’s what makes us so successful. But somewhere along the line, many of us became too proud to ask for help. My car was off the road this week, so I had to ask for a ride to Inverness. It felt weird, but you know what? The person I asked was genuinely happy to help, and we had a great day together.
It got me thinking: why do we resist asking for help so much? Whether a big life challenge or a simple task, we all need support sometimes. I see this all the time as a coach—people banging their heads against the same wall, refusing to ask for help to get through it. There’s no big revelation here, just a reminder: sometimes we have to surrender and ask for that support.

Join me in an incredibly inspiring conversation with Marty Cornish, a man whose journey from a challenging childhood to becoming a thriving entrepreneur and mentor is nothing short of remarkable. Marty shares candid details about growing up in a dysfunctional environment, the struggles of moving between different schools, and the impact of having a stepfather battling he**in addiction.
Despite these hardships, Marty’s story is one of resilience and ambition. Discover how his entrepreneurial spirit blossomed early on, leading him to collect and sell golf balls as a kid, and how his determination propelled him into the military and later into the business world. Marty opens up about the role his grandparents played in providing stability and how reconnecting with his biological father helped him find peace.
Now, Marty's mission is to help others, especially men in their 30s, find their purpose and regain their self-confidence. Through his new Spartan Mindset program, he aims to guide others in overcoming adversity, cutting negative habits, and building a life they can be proud of. On this shortcast, we're diving into a super intriguing topic: happiness. Have you ever wondered why that new car or pay raise doesn't keep you happy for long? It's all about your happiness set point.Join me as we chat about how our minds adapt to new joys, why gratitude is essential, and how you can consciously shift your happiness level. I'll share some personal stories and insights from experts like Philip Brickman and Donald T. Campbell, and we'll explore practical tips to keep your life vibrant and exciting.The point is that we are hardwired to habituate any experience, making it our new normal. This is called the hedonic tread, and while it may steel our joy, it is there to keep us safe.

At 16 Rich Morley was diagnosed with Fibromyalgia, by 30 he was medically retired and living on benefits, today he is fully recovered and supporting others to turn their own lives around. How did he do it? Through the healing power of Tai chi.
This remarkable story is a lesson in never giving up, even when the medical profession has given up on you. It is about discovering what is possible beyond medical intervention. And it is about harnessing the power of belief to turn your life around.
As our conversation unfolds, you will gain insight into the history and power of Tai chi, both as an aid to healing and as a martial art practice.

Today, we're diving into the intriguing concept of simplicity vs. complexity. Have you ever noticed how we naturally tend to add more stuff to our lives instead of taking things away? Let's explore why that is and how we can shift our mindset to embrace simplicity.
This week, I was fascinated by a conversation on the Hidden Brain podcast with Leidy Klotz, a professor at Virginia University. He shared a story about building blocks with his child. He would tend towards adding blocks while his son would take them away. It got me thinking about our cultural tendencies to complicate things and how we might benefit from doing the opposite. Do we need all this complexity, or is there a way to live more meaningfully by stripping back?What are we hiding from or masking with the complexity?
Join me as I reflect on my life and the accumulated clutter, especially in our busy schedules. I'll share insights on how saying 'no' can empower and how Eastern philosophies like Buddhism advocate for a simpler, more focused existence. Whether it's our personal lives or business strategies, sometimes less truly is more.
